| Post Translational Modification | The anchoring of this receptor to the plasma membrane is probably mediated by the palmitoylation of a cysteine residue. |
| Function | This is a receptor for the tachykinin neuropeptide neuromedin-K (neurokinin B). It is associated with G proteins that activate a phosphatidylinositol-calcium second messenger system. The rank order of affinity of this receptor to tachykinins is- neuromedin-K substance K substance P. |
